Default heh, i skidded on dry surface at low speed, banged the entire side

Driving in city, approaching intersection at about 15mph, see an open spot to make a left turn, tap the accelerator and turn the wheel - the entire car turns yet skids sideways and hits the curb, first the front right wheel, followed by rear.

I have stock 8-spoke rims (non-sport 4.2). The front wheel has a really bad case of curb rash, the rear wheel is better, but nothing broke off.

Once I hit a curb with my rear wheel in an older audi (1993 Audi 100 CS quattro), and a quarter of the disk broke off at much lighter impact.

I can attest that stock wheels are very strong.
